
Senator Marco Rubio has publicly criticised former US President Donald Trump over reports of a private meeting with Ukrainian leader Volodymyr Zelensky. The alleged encounter has sparked debate over diplomatic norms and potential political ramifications.
Diplomatic Protocol Under Scrutiny
Rubio, a senior Republican figure, expressed unease about the nature of the meeting, suggesting it may have bypassed standard diplomatic channels. "When private citizens engage in foreign policy without transparency, it creates unnecessary complications," the Florida senator stated.
Trump's Ukraine History
The controversy comes against the backdrop of Trump's impeachment in 2019, which stemmed from his dealings with Ukraine. Political analysts suggest this latest development could reignite discussions about Trump's approach to international relations.
White House Response
Current administration officials have declined to comment on the reported meeting, though sources indicate the State Department was unaware of any such discussions. A spokesperson for Zelensky's office offered no confirmation of the encounter.
Political observers note the timing is particularly sensitive as Ukraine continues its defence against Russian aggression while seeking continued Western support.
